Landslide Strikes Hunza Gilgit-Baltistan, Leaving Nine Dead
At least nine volunteers lost their lives. Three others were critically injure. The disaster occurred near Manoga Nullah in Gilgit. The monsoon season is affecting the Northern Areas the most. With frequent landslides and heavy rains the tourists are advised not to take risks. Earlier this season multiple incidents happen at different regions causing several casualties.
Heavy Rains Triggered the Tragedy
Recent heavy rainfall caused the landslide. Local volunteers were assisting in relief efforts when the disaster struck. The landslide also blocked key roads. Hunza Valley is now cut off from surrounding areas.
Flooding Threatens Over 50 Homes in Hassanabad
The landslide worsened flooding risks. Over 50 houses in Hassanabad are under threat. Rescue teams are working to evacuate residents. Emergency response efforts are underway. Initial reports confirm nine fatalities. The number could rise as search operations continue. Authorities fear more landslides due to unstable terrain.
Calls for Immediate Relief and Support
Officials urge emergency aid for affected families. Roads must be clear to restore access. The government has been asked to appoint disaster response teams.
